I saw the Clash at a one-off gig at Rafters Manchester in 1978. Joe had apparently gone down with a throat infection and the band had postponed an earlier concert the day before. Myself and a few friends shared a few drinks with him and the band before going on stage. No airs and graces with Joe as with other musicians at the time. We were all part of the same scene. Definitely a man of principle. RIP Joe Strummer.

In 78 they did the 'out on parole ' tour which i seen at Glasgow Apollo, was my first gig as a 16 year old. The Specials (the Coventry aka )and American outfit Suicide were the support. I seen both nights of their London Calling tour at the same venue. I also seen them being bundled into that police van at the first gig. ...I'll die happy 👍

If it hasn't already been noted by another commenter(s), his earlier band that he was in before forming The Clash was called The 101ers -- some songs that appeared on their "Eglin Avenue" album would get rerecorded onto subsequent Clash albums ("Jail Guitar Doors" being one such track, I believe)
